在Ubuntu系統上使用SecureCRT進行日志查看的步驟如下:
創建日志存放目錄: 在電腦磁盤中創建一個用于存放日志文件的目錄,建議該目錄位于空間較大的非系統盤下。
配置SecureCRT會話:
Options
-> Configure Default Sessions
打開默認會話配置選項。Session.log
,并根據需要添加自定義參數信息,例如 %H_%S_%Y-%M-%D_%h%m%s_session.log
,其中 %H
、%S
、%Y
、%M
、%D
、%h
、%m
、%s
分別代表主機名、會話名、年、月、日、時、分、秒。設置日志會話選項:
start log upon connect
(連接時啟動)、append to file
(應用到文件)、start new log at midnight
(午夜開始新的日志,文件名稱必須包含日期 %D
)。定義日志文件數據:
Upon connect
(連接后)、On each line
(每條日志上)添加需要記錄的時間信息,例如 [%Y-%M-%D_%h:%m:%s]
[%h:%m:%s]
,用于記錄會話創建時間與每條命令配置時間。將配置應用至全部會話:
OK
按鈕保存會話配置,并將配置應用到全部會話,這樣每次登錄設備后即可自動記錄會話日志。在Ubuntu系統中,可以使用以下命令行工具來查看系統日志文件:
使用 journalctl
命令:
journalctl
journalctl -b
journalctl -u 服務名稱
journalctl --since "2021-01-01" --until "2021-01-31"
。使用 cat
、less
、grep
等命令查看和分析日志文件:
cat
命令查看日志文件內容。less
命令分頁查看日志文件內容。grep
命令過濾日志文件內容。通過以上步驟,你可以在Ubuntu系統中使用SecureCRT有效地查看和管理日志文件,從而提高工作效率和問題追溯能力。